From d7e0a8ad6b7033725c77a5e0818bd7ed098cc870 Mon Sep 17 00:00:00 2001 From: John Crispin Date: Fri, 13 Jun 2025 06:16:30 +0200 Subject: [PATCH] ucentral-client: only start the service if the operational cert is present Fixes: WIFI-14694 Signed-off-by: John Crispin --- feeds/ucentral/ucentral-client/files/etc/init.d/ucentral | 1 + 1 file changed, 1 insertion(+) diff --git a/feeds/ucentral/ucentral-client/files/etc/init.d/ucentral b/feeds/ucentral/ucentral-client/files/etc/init.d/ucentral index 5b2e6bff2..d00b1b5cc 100755 --- a/feeds/ucentral/ucentral-client/files/etc/init.d/ucentral +++ b/feeds/ucentral/ucentral-client/files/etc/init.d/ucentral @@ -14,6 +14,7 @@ reload_service() { } start_service() { + [ -f /etc/ucentral/operational.ca -a -f /etc/ucentral/operational.pem ] || return [ -s /etc/ucentral/capabilities.json ] || rm /etc/ucentral/capabilities.json [ -f /etc/ucentral/capabilities.json ] || /usr/share/ucentral/capabilities.uc